The truth: If you're still issuing ineffective press releases, you're destined to be left behind by this era.

The landscape of media and communication has shifted dramatically over the past decade. In a world where information moves at lightning speed and audiences are bombarded with content daily, the traditional press release has struggled to maintain its relevance. Many organizations still rely on outdated methods, sending out generic announcements in the hope of catching media attention. This approach often falls short of achieving meaningful engagement. The reality is that if your press releases fail to resonate, they might as well not exist. It's a harsh truth that many teams are only beginning to grasp.

In the early stages of my career, I observed numerous companies investing heavily in press releases without seeing a tangible return on investment. These communications were often crafted with little consideration for the audience or the broader media landscape. The result was a flood of sameness that journalists quickly learned to ignore. Over time, it became evident that simply sending out a press release was no longer enough. The quality of the content and its alignment with audience interests had become far more critical.

The effectiveness of a press release now hinges on its ability to tell a compelling story. Journalists are inundated with pitches daily, and they have little patience for fluff or irrelevant information. A well-crafted release must capture attention quickly and provide value that goes beyond a simple announcement. This requires a deep understanding of the audience and the media outlets you're targeting. Many teams find themselves struggling to adapt, clinging to familiar templates because they lack the resources or expertise to create something truly engaging.

One common pitfall is the failure to tailor the message to specific audiences. A one-size-fits-all approach rarely works in today's media environment. Media outlets have distinct readerships and editorial standards, and failing to recognize these differences can render your press release ineffective. In my experience, organizations that invest time in researching and understanding their target media are more likely to see positive outcomes. This involves more than just listing contacts; it means understanding their perspectives and what they value in a story.

The rise of digital platforms has further complicated the landscape. Social media has democratized content distribution, allowing smaller stories to gain traction quickly if they resonate with audiences. Meanwhile, traditional media outlets are increasingly reliant on digital metrics to gauge success. This shift means that press releases must be designed with both traditional and digital considerations in mind. Simply formatting a release for print is no longer sufficient; it must also perform well online.

Many teams discover that their press releases are not reaching the intended audience because they lack visibility in search engines or social media feeds. SEO best practices have become essential for ensuring that your content gets noticed by both journalists and end consumers. This doesn't mean stuffing keywords into every sentence but rather creating content that naturally incorporates relevant terms and themes. Over time, this approach has proven far more effective than relying on generic phrases or buzzwords.

The role of data analytics has also become increasingly important in evaluating press release performance. Organizations now have access to tools that can track metrics such as open rates, click-through rates, and engagement levels across various platforms. These insights can help refine future efforts by identifying what works and what doesn't. However, many teams still struggle to integrate data-driven decision-making into their processes, relying instead on intuition or past experiences.

In recent years, I've seen a growing trend toward personalized and interactive press releases. Rather than static documents sent via email, some organizations are experimenting with multimedia formats that include videos, infographics, and interactive elements. These innovations have shown promise in capturing attention and driving engagement but require significant resources to produce effectively. For many teams, this represents a daunting challenge given budget constraints and limited expertise.

The competitive landscape has also forced organizations to reconsider their approach to press releases altogether. In industries where every dollar counts, it's becoming increasingly difficult to justify spending on traditional PR methods without clear ROI data. This shift has led some companies to explore alternative strategies such as influencer marketing or content partnerships instead of relying solely on press releases for visibility.
